PORT ARTHUR, Texas - A man and two women who have his name tattooed on their necks have been indicted on organized crime charges after allegedly running a prostitution ring in the Port Arthur area.
A Jefferson County grand jury indicted the trio on charges after an undercover sex offense investigation. The arrests were announced Thursday.
The suspects include Edwin Johnson a.k.a. "Head," Casandra Lettau a.k.a "Snow" and Jessica Gooden a.k.a "Honey."
Investigators tracked the ring in part by using coupons, allegedly advertising the operation, showing scantily clad women.
Groves City Marshal Jeff Wilmore says it was a "very flamboyant, in your face lifestyle."
According to a KDFW report, that flamboyance included jewel-encrusted mouth jewelry emblazoned with the word "pimp," and houses painted in distinctive blue and white patterns.
Engaging in organized criminal activity is a felony and can bring a sentence of up to 20 years in prison.
